Transaction 12fa8644965516ccb4076caf0c508192c77ab3209974464cc5b74ebeaa84fab6

1 Input
2 Outputs
  • 12fa8644965516ccb4076caf0c508192c77ab3209974464cc5b74ebeaa84fab6:0
  • value  77224
    address  3A8BYCBjA2Yvbfbg8eTaDrUhnkeNGtzkiR
  • 12fa8644965516ccb4076caf0c508192c77ab3209974464cc5b74ebeaa84fab6:1
  • value  19053
    address  39PKNJiwhAVPChMFWq3gjVXSy63ErjuvMJ